Faulting Application - MSVCR90.DLL
Hello guys.

What problem could this be?

Faulting application sphereSvr.exe, version 0.56.2.0, time stamp 0x4ab67f60, faulting module MSVCR90.dll, version 9.0.21022.8, time stamp 0x47313dce, exception code 0xc00000fd, fault offset 0x0005de2a, process id 0xc94, application start time 0x01cd6e63e508c46b.

The host is a Server Web Edition 2008 4gb of ram..
Had to install VC Redist 2008 to have sphere run on the machine.

I did a SFC /SCANNOW, no problems founds.

It just... randomly crash, after 10-15 minutes..
Did not do any script update before that started to happen, was good for about 24 hours..

Any idea anyone?

I just redownloaded the DLL and put it under system32, will see if it fixes it.. otherwise.. I really don't know what to do..

Comment networkthreads and networkpriority, set asyncnetwork=0.

(08-01-2012 06:21 AM)Handred Wrote:  Why do you suggest that?
Because Sphere with default ini is unstable, but disabling of this options make it stable. (If no, set also UsePacketPriority=0.)
